internal void InsertSalesDetails(SalesDetails instance, string invstatus) { base.com.CommandText = "spInsertSalesDetailsByItem"; base.com.Parameters.AddWithValue("_InvNo", instance.InvNo); base.com.Parameters.AddWithValue("_ProdID", instance.ProdID); base.com.Parameters.AddWithValue("_Qty", instance.Qty); base.com.Parameters.AddWithValue("_UnitPx", instance.UnitPx); base.com.Parameters.AddWithValue("_Prodname", instance.ProdName_); base.com.Parameters.AddWithValue("_IMEI", instance.IMEI_); base.com.Parameters.AddWithValue("_Discount", instance.Discount); base.com.Parameters.AddWithValue("_InvStatus", invstatus); try { int res = Convert.ToInt32(base.com.ExecuteScalar()); } catch (Exception e) { throw new Exception(e.Message); } finally { closeConnection(); } }
public static List<SalesDetails> GetSalesDetailsByInvno(string invno) { var dal = new SalesDetailsDAL(); var collection = new List<SalesDetails>(); foreach(DataRow row in dal.GetSalesDetailsByInvno(invno).Rows){ var instance = new SalesDetails(); instance.Bind(row); collection.Add(instance); } return collection; }
public static List <SalesDetails> GetSalesDetailsByInvno(string invno) { var dal = new SalesDetailsDAL(); var collection = new List <SalesDetails>(); foreach (DataRow row in dal.GetSalesDetailsByInvno(invno).Rows) { var instance = new SalesDetails(); instance.Bind(row); collection.Add(instance); } return(collection); }
public static void InsertSalesDetails(SalesDetails instance, string invstatus) { var dal = new SalesDetailsDAL(); dal.InsertSalesDetails(instance, invstatus); }